Type alias MessageDataNodeInternal

MessageDataNode: {
    channel?: {
        id: string;
        matcher: string;
        name: string;
    };
    mention?: {
        avatar?: string;
        color: string;
        id: number | string;
        matcher: string;
        name: string;
        nickname?: boolean;
        type: string;
    };
    reaction?: {
        id: string;
    };
}

The mentions this message might contain

Type declaration

  • Optional channel?: {
        id: string;
        matcher: string;
        name: string;
    }
    • id: string
    • matcher: string
    • name: string
  • Optional mention?: {
        avatar?: string;
        color: string;
        id: number | string;
        matcher: string;
        name: string;
        nickname?: boolean;
        type: string;
    }
    • Optional avatar?: string
    • color: string
    • id: number | string
    • matcher: string
    • name: string
    • Optional nickname?: boolean
    • type: string
  • Optional reaction?: {
        id: string;
    }
    • id: string

Generated using TypeDoc